TORONTO, Jan. 03, 2018 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Quinsam Capital Corporation (“Quinsam”) (CSE:QCA) is pleased to announce that it has completed or agreed to complete a number of investments following its recent equity financings.  Also, Quinsam wishes to update investors on the strong performance by a number of the companies in its portfolio.

New Investments

In recent weeks, Quinsam has been actively deploying funds raised from our recent financings.  We anticipate announcing a number of additional new investments as funds are deployed.

PlantExt Ltd.

We purchased US$250,000 of common shares in PlantExt Ltd.  PlantExt is an Israel-based company focused on the use of cannabis for the treatment of inflammation related diseases.  We are hopeful that the company will seek a Canadian listing in 2018.

Xanthic Biopharma Limited

We purchased $300,000 of common shares in Xanthic Biopharma Limited. Xanthic has developed cannabis-related delivery technologies.  The most exciting one for us is a technology to create good tasting powdered beverages.  We are hopeful that the company will seek a Canadian listing in 2018.

Aura Health Corp.

We purchased $300,000 of convertible debentures issued by Aura Health CorpAura Health is an operator of cannabis clinics in Nevada, Arizona and Florida.  They plan to open clinics in Germany in 2018.  We are hopeful that the company will seek a Canadian listing in 2018.

Seed Capital

We purchased two tranches totalling $200,000 of common shares and warrants in Seed Capital Corp.  Seed Capital Corp. in a cannabis investment vehicle run by Robert Josephson, who was an early leader in the Canadian cannabis space.

Segra International Corp. 

We were able to secure a small $100,000 common share investment in Segra International Corp.  We would have bought more but this was all that was available to us.  Segra is a specialist in cannabis plantlet production and developing a cannabis tissue production facility in California.  The company is an applicant to become a licensed produce user in Canada as well.  

Doja Cannabis Company Limited

We purchased $300,000 in units of Doja convertible debentures and warrants as part of its recent financing.  The common shares recently traded at $2.50.  Our debentures convert at $1.24 and our warrants strike at $1.86.

Rocky Mountain Marijuana Inc.

We purchased $250,000 of common shares in the capital of Rocky Mountain Marijuana Inc.  Rocky Mountain is an ACMPR applicant.  We are hopeful that the company will seek a Canadian listing in 2018.

Georgian Bay Biomed Ltd.

We purchased $300,000 of common shares and warrants in the capital of Georgian Bay Biomed Ltd.  Georgian Bay is an ACMPR applicant with a very attractive contraction financing package.  We are hopeful that the company will seek a Canadian listing in 2018.

We also topped up our investment in Osoyoos Cannabis to a total investment of $500,000.

About Quinsam Capital Corporation

Quinsam is a merchant bank based in Canada that is focusing on cannabis-related investments.  Our merchant banking business may encompass a range of activities including acquisitions, advisory services, lending activities and portfolio investments. Quinsam invests its capital for its own account in assets, companies or projects which we believe are undervalued and where we see a viable plan for unlocking such value. We do not invest on behalf of any third party and we do not offer investment advice. 

Generally, Quinsam does not believe that individual investments are material reportable events.  Quinsam chooses to announce certain investments once the company is certain that it has finished buying its position because the Company feels that this information helps Quinsam’s investors understand its investment decision making process.  Generally, Quinsam does not announce the sale of investments.
